Effective strategy development hinges on understanding non-state actors and insurgent activities, which have surged in recent years. This book examines the concept of the Center of Gravity (CoG) in the context of counterinsurgency (COIN) strategies, questioning whether traditional military models are suitable for addressing insurgencies. Through a case study of Iraq, it highlights how misconceptions and biases among civil and military leaders impacted strategic decisions. The work challenges readers to reconsider the relevance of CoG in combating contemporary insurgent threats.
